Mentoring is a key component of the Courage to Care training process and we encourage all experienced facilitators to take this on.
Facilitators with two or more years of experience are invited to take a lead facilitator role, supporting trainees on the ground at school programs. Senior facilitators who are interested in taking a broader mentoring relationship to assist new trainees through the whole training process can take the further training to qualify as Buddies.
Online module, approx 1.5 hr to complete in your own time.
For facilitators with two or more years of facilitation experience who would like to support trainees to develop their skills.
Module covers mentoring skills and techniques for providing feedback to trainees; and administrative requirements.
Complete a self-test quiz at the end.
